I have a 2006 ford 450 with the V-10 gas engine and the 5 speed torqshift transmission. I do not like the way it shifts when in the tow/haul mode. Does any one know if it is possible to get the tow-haul re-programmed to a different shift pattern either by a dealer or an aftermarket place??
T/H mode is setup to keep the tranny in a gear longer, preventing the tranny from hunting through the gears,,,,really only seem to need it when towing Heavy trailers,,my trailer's can weigh in 5 to 8k lbs,,and I rarely use T/H mode,,,,mostly when braking,,,the braking feature works sweet on my truck!
I think if you change the shift points when in tow-haul mode it defeats the purpose which is to prevent gear hunting as m350 said above. On my truck the gear changes are not quite as smooth in tow-haul mode but I have always attributed that to the fact that the engine was at a higher RPM.
